WebOct 7, 2024 · When light flashes ( positive dysphotopsias) occur after cataract surgery, they usually appear briefly in your peripheral vision or slightly off to the side of objects you’re looking at. In some cases, people may notice shadows ( negative dysphotopsias) rather than light flashes in their peripheral vision after surgery.
